What Is a Hob?
A hob, often referred to as a cooktop or range top, is the flat surface area on which pots and pans are positioned for cooking. best hobs uk are equipped with heating components that generate the needed heat for cooking food. They can be found in various forms, consisting of gas, electric, induction, and ceramic options. Each type offers special benefits and downsides.
Types of Hobs
Gas Hobs:
- Heat Source: Natural gas or gas.
- Advantages: Instant heat control and responsiveness, chosen by numerous chefs for accurate cooking.
- Disadvantages: Requires a gas connection and can be less energy-efficient.
Electric Hobs:
- Heat Source: Electric coils or smooth glass-ceramic surface areas.
- Advantages: Generally easier to clean, even heating, and commonly available.
- Drawbacks: Slower to warm up and cool off compared to gas.
Induction Hobs:
- Heat Source: Electromagnetic currents.
- Benefits: Quick heating, energy-efficient, and only heats the cookware, not the surrounding surface area.
- Drawbacks: Requires compatible pots and pans (ferrous products).
Ceramic Hobs:
- Heat Source: Electric and has a smooth glass surface area.
- Advantages: Sleek appearance, simple to tidy, and even heating.
- Disadvantages: Can take longer to warm up and cool off.
What Is an Oven?
An oven is an enclosed device that cooks food by surrounding it with dry heat. ovens uk can be standalone systems or hobs and ovens combined with hobs in a single device understood as a range. Ovens are flexible tools that can be utilized for baking, roasting, broiling, and more.
Types of Ovens
Standard Ovens:
- Heat Source: Electric or gas.
- Benefits: Good for standard baking and roasting.
- Downsides: Can have uneven heat distribution.
Convection Ovens:
- Heat Source: Electric or gas with a fan for distributing air.
- Advantages: More even cooking and faster cooking times due to airflow.
- Disadvantages: Can be costlier and might need modifications in cooking times.
Microwave Ovens:
- Heat Source: Microwaves.
- Advantages: Quick cooking and reheating; great for defrosting.
- Disadvantages: Can not brown or crisp food well.
Steam Ovens:
- Heat Source: Steam generation.
- Advantages: Retains nutrients and wetness in food, healthier cooking option.
- Disadvantages: Longer cooking times and usually greater cost.
Key Differences Between Hobs and Ovens
While hobs and ovens serve the primary function of cooking food, their performances and utilizes differ considerably. The following table sums up these key differences:
Feature | Hob | Oven |
---|---|---|
Cooking Method | Direct heat | Confined heat |
Primary Use | Boiling, sautéing, frying | Baking, roasting |
Heat Source | Gas, electric, induction | Gas, electric, steam |
Cooking Area | Flat surface | Enclosed area |
Cooking Time | Generally quicker | Differs based on dish |
Control & & Precision | Immediate and direct | Relies on settings and timers |

Upkeep and Care
To ensure the longevity of hobs and ovens, routine maintenance is important. Here are some ideas:
For Hobs:
- Clean spills right away to avoid staining.
- Usage proper cleaners for specific products (e.g., ceramic cleaner for glass-ceramic hobs).
- Frequently inspect gas connections for leaks (for gas best hobs uk).
For Ovens:
- Wipe down the interior after each use to prevent build-up.
- Usage self-cleaning features if readily available, or use oven cleaners for difficult spots.
- Regularly check seals and gaskets for wear and tear (to preserve heat efficiency).
FAQs About Hobs and Ovens
1. What is the best kind of hob for a newbie cook?
Response: A ceramic or electric hob is frequently advised for newbies due to reduce of use and cleaning.
2. Can I utilize any cookware on an induction hob?
Answer: No, induction hobs need pots and pans made from magnetic products (e.g., cast iron or stainless-steel).
3. How typically should I clean my oven?
Answer: It is a good idea to clean your oven every few months, or more regularly if you utilize it frequently.
4. Is it better to bake in a stove?
Answer: Yes, convection ovens are frequently better for baking as they provide even heat distribution. Nevertheless, some delicate recipes might gain from traditional ovens.
